BUSINESSES CONTRIBUTE TO 5TH ANNUAL SALUTE TO THE STARS GALA

 

With the generous support of several local businesses, the Cypress-Fairbanks Independent School District and the Cypress-Fairbanks Educational Foundation (CFEF) is set to host the 5th annual Salute to the Stars gala September 19 at Cypress Ridge High School in honor of the district’s outstanding Spotlight Teachers for 2002.

The Outback Steak House located at 13240 U.S. 290 will once again be donating the meal for the gala, marking the fourth consecutive year that the restaurant has demonstrated its generosity for this event. The restaurant will also be providing the dessert for this year’s event, making Outback’s donation worth approximately $8,700.

Outback General Manager Mike Sheehy said that the company was founded on the idea that giving back to the community was important and that education is important to the community. He added that the gala was a special occasion for so many in that it recognizes the role models and mentors of the community.

"We all know how important teachers are and that they are really never shown the amount of appreciation they truly deserve. The gala is one way that the people of Outback and the rest of the community can show our appreciation and say thanks for their devotion," Sheehy said.

In addition to Outback’s contribution, Steel Supply, Inc. and Edward Station & Associates Insurance Services will serve as underwriters for this year’s Salute to the Stars gala. This marks the first year that the ceremony has attracted underwriters.

Superintendent Rick Berry thanked the business owners and managers for their continued support. He added that their generous contributions reflected a strong commitment to the children and teachers of Cypress-Fairbanks ISD.

"I know this certainly means a lot to our teachers. It makes them feel good because these businesses have volunteered their time as well as their goods and services year after year," Berry said. "The gala is one of our most special events each year because it’s about honoring our teachers, and it’s truly a high-quality event because of the generosity of our business partners. We appreciate them for being so willing to help with the gala."

The Salute to the Stars gala also serves as the primary fund-raising event for the Cypress-Fairbanks Educational Foundation’s Instructional Excellence Grant program. In spring of 2002, the Foundation awarded more than $54,000 to 38 CFISD teachers for grant programs that were implemented this school year.
